Baltic dry index - 1578

Today, Friday, October 20 2017, the Baltic Dry Index decreased by 4 points, reaching 1578 points.
Baltic Dry Index is compiled by the London-based Baltic Exchange and covers prices for transported cargo such as coal, grain and iron ore. The index is based on a daily survey of agents all over the world. Baltic Dry hit a temporary peak on May 20, 2008, when the index hit 11,793. The lowest level ever reached was on Wednesday the 10th of February 2016, when the index dropped to 290 points.

US rig count - 913

HOUSTON (AP) - The number of rigs exploring for oil and natural gas in the U.S. declined by 15 this week to 913.
That's up from the 553 rigs that were active a year ago.
Houston oilfield services company Baker Hughes said Friday that 736 rigs sought oil and 177 explored for natural gas this week.
Among major oil- and gas-producing states, Texas lost eight rigs, Alaska and Wyoming each declined by two and New Mexico and Utah each lost one.
Arkansas, California, Colorado, Kansas, Louisiana, North Dakota, Ohio, Oklahoma, Pennsylvania and West Virginia were unchanged.
The U.S. rig count peaked at 4,530 in 1981. It bottomed out in May of 2016 at 404.

ECB will start QE tapering in Jan 2018.

https://sg.finance.yahoo.com/news/ecb-gently-trim-asset-buys-delicate-messaging-act-063209193--business.html

ECB will start reducing bond purchases by $20B euros in Jan 2018.  The bond purchases will reduce from $60b to $40b in Jan 2018 and will continue to reduce gradually over time.
